THE GAME: The Angels saw their losing streak reach three games with an 8-1 defeat to the Cleveland Guardians in a Cactus League on Tuesday in Goodyear, Ariz.
PITCHING REPORT: Right-hander Jack Kochanowicz made his second start of the spring and first since missing time because of an illness and had one strikeout over three scoreless innings. He allowed three hits on 45 pitches. Fellow fifth-starter candidate Caden Dana struggled to the tune of seven runs allowed on five hits and four walks while recording just one out on 47 pitches. Dana gave up a home run to Yordys Valdes. “Each inning, he went out there he walked the first batter, and he just couldn’t command,” Manager Ron Washington said of Dana.
HITTING REPORT: Logan O’Hoppe continued his hot-hitting spring with a fifth-inning double off the wall in left-center field. O’Hoppe went 1 for 2 with a walk and is now 6 for 11 with two doubles in five Cactus League games. … Nelson Rada drove in his sixth run of the spring in nine games with a bloop single to center field in the third inning for his fifth hit. … Third-base candidate J.D. Davis reached base twice on a single and a walk.
DEFENSIVE REPORT: A day after Washington said Jo Adell was “growing” as a center fielder, there was proof of it when he made a diving catch on a sinking line drive from Bo Naylor to end the fourth inning. “He might have been having a rough time in the beginning (in center field) but it’s gonna straighten itself out,” Washington said.
